How they compare

Italy currently reports 112.4% against 111.5% in Micronesia, Federated States of, a difference of 0.9%.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 15 shared years of data; in 2007 it was Italy ahead.

Italy ranks 19th and Micronesia, Federated States of ranks 21st of 165 countries.

Italy has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Primary government expenditures as a proportion of original approved budget measures the extent to which aggregate budget expenditure outturn reflects the amount originally approved, as defined in government budget documentation and fiscal reports. The coverage is budgetary central government (BCG) and the time period covered is the last three completed fiscal years.
